Output 63348cc33345d38bf724455c56c65f4df64b247176f9e95c3c98a1aa51e8caec:4

value
878430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02306e4f2883f11c6bb3137e3246ee81be31fd71 OP_EQUAL
address
31tbHxva7Hrb2x6A9VTu2ZjDrfwofeRpY2
transaction
63348cc33345d38bf724455c56c65f4df64b247176f9e95c3c98a1aa51e8caec
spent
true